PHE Engineer
Job Summary
- Designing and developing plumbing system layouts with team of draftsman including pipe sizing and equipment selection calculations with experience preferred in Airport projects.
- Preparing detailed plumbing construction documents DBR Boq Specifications and material schedules.
- Collaborating with architects engineers client & contractors to ensure the successful implementation of plumbing systems.
- Conducting site visits to evaluate existing plumbing systems and identify potential issues or improvements as per project requirements.
- Providing technical support and guidance to project site teams throughout the construction process.
- Staying up-to-date with industry standards and regulations related to plumbing & fire fighting system design.
- Troubleshooting and resolving any plumbing system issues that arise during construction or operation of existing delivered project.
Qualifications :
Bachelors degree in mechanical/civil engineering or a related field with 6 years of experience or Diploma in Mechanical/Civil Engineering or a related field with 6 years of experience.
